Touring cycling around Elsau offers routes through varied landscapes, characterized by gentle river valleys and open countryside. The region features a network of paths alongside waterways like the Eulach Canal, connecting natural areas with historical sites. Elevation changes are generally mild, making the area suitable for accessible cycling. The terrain primarily consists of paved and well-maintained gravel paths, ideal for touring bikes.

There are over 10 touring cycling routes around Elsau, offering a variety of experiences. These include easy, moderate, and some more challenging options, ensuring there's something for every skill level.
Yes, Elsau offers several easy touring bike trails perfect for beginners and families. Routes like the Eulach Canal in Hegi – Winterthur City Hall loop from Räterschen, an 8.5-mile (13.8 km) easy trail, follow gentle canal paths and are largely flat, making them ideal for a relaxed ride. Another great option is the Pathway Through a Small Park – Eulachersteg loop from Räterschen, which offers parkland scenery and riverside sections.
Yes, many of the touring cycling routes around Elsau are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. For example, the Iisweier Pond – Hegi Castle loop from Schottikon is a 26.3-mile (42.4 km) circular trail that takes you through scenic areas and past historical sites.
The touring bike trails near Elsau vary in distance, catering to different preferences. You can find shorter loops around 8.5 miles (13.8 km), such as the Eulach Canal in Hegi – Winterthur City Hall loop from Räterschen, up to longer routes like the Iisweier Pond loop from Räterschen, which covers about 22.3 miles (35.8 km).
Elsau's touring cycling routes often pass by a mix of natural and historical landmarks. You can explore areas around Iisweier Pond, cycle past the historic Hegi Castle, or follow the Eulach Canal. For more natural beauty, consider visiting nearby gorges with waterfalls like the Hutziker Tobel Waterfalls or the Farenbachtobel Gorge.
Yes, the region around Elsau features several beautiful waterfalls within accessible distance from cycling routes. Notable examples include the Hutziker Tobel Waterfalls, Farenbachtobel Gorge, and the Bäntal Waterfall and Metal Staircase, offering scenic stops during your tour.

Parking options are generally available near the starting points of many routes in Elsau, particularly in larger villages or near popular attractions. For specific routes, it's advisable to check the route details on komoot for recommended parking spots, often found near train stations or public facilities in towns like Räterschen or Schottikon.
Elsau is well-connected by public transport, making it easy to access the cycling routes without a car. Train stations in towns like Räterschen and Schottikon serve as convenient starting points for many tours, including the Eulach Canal in Hegi – Hegi Castle loop from Räterschen. Check local train schedules for the best connections.
The best time for touring cycling in Elsau is typically from spring through autumn (April to October). During these months, the weather is generally mild and pleasant, with less rainfall and comfortable temperatures for longer rides. The paths are usually dry and the natural scenery is at its most vibrant.
Yes, many touring cycling routes in Elsau pass through or near villages and towns where you can find cafes, restaurants, and shops for refreshments. Routes that go through urban settings, such as those connecting to Winterthur, offer ample opportunities for breaks and meals. It's always a good idea to carry some snacks and water, especially on longer stretches.
